lp:~dbarth/ubuntu-system-settings-online-accounts/inline-plugin
- Get this branch:
- bzr branch lp:~dbarth/ubuntu-system-settings-online-accounts/inline-plugin
Branch merges
- Alberto Mardegan: Needs Fixing
- PS Jenkins bot: Pending (continuous-integration) requested
-
Diff: 435 lines (+62/-258)9 files modifiedsrc/online-accounts-ui.pro (+0/-10)
src/ui.qrc (+0/-10)
system-settings-plugin/AccountEditPage.qml (+6/-21)
system-settings-plugin/MainPage.qml (+29/-45)
system-settings-plugin/ProviderPluginList.qml (+10/-15)
system-settings-plugin/online-accounts.settings (+1/-1)
system-settings-plugin/plugin.cpp (+0/-89)
system-settings-plugin/plugin.h (+0/-38)
system-settings-plugin/system-settings-plugin.pro (+16/-29)
- PS Jenkins bot (community): Needs Fixing (continuous-integration)
- Online Accounts: Pending requested
-
Diff: 2212 lines (+1631/-147)37 files modified.bzrignore (+1/-0)
debian/control (+0/-1)
src/browser-request.cpp (+5/-15)
src/module/OAuth.qml (+0/-1)
src/module/WebView.qml (+1/-2)
src/module/qmldir.in (+2/-0)
src/notification.cpp (+8/-0)
src/notification.h (+1/-0)
src/online-accounts-ui.pro (+2/-1)
src/qml/SignOnUiPage.qml (+40/-0)
src/signonui-request.cpp (+101/-46)
src/ui.qrc (+1/-0)
system-settings-plugin/AccountEditPage.qml (+66/-0)
system-settings-plugin/AccountItem.qml (+59/-0)
system-settings-plugin/AccountsPage.qml (+65/-0)
system-settings-plugin/AddAccountLabel.qml (+28/-0)
system-settings-plugin/AuthorizationPage.qml (+75/-0)
system-settings-plugin/EntryComponent.qml (+33/-0)
system-settings-plugin/MainPage.qml (+66/-0)
system-settings-plugin/NewAccountPage.qml (+38/-0)
system-settings-plugin/NoAccountsPage.qml (+54/-0)
system-settings-plugin/NormalStartupPage.qml (+46/-0)
system-settings-plugin/ProviderPluginList.qml (+42/-0)
system-settings-plugin/ProvidersList.qml (+62/-0)
system-settings-plugin/online-accounts.settings (+2/-1)
system-settings-plugin/plugin.cpp (+17/-70)
system-settings-plugin/plugin.h (+6/-9)
system-settings-plugin/system-settings-plugin.pro (+18/-0)
tests/online-accounts-ui/data/com.ubuntu.tests_application.application (+19/-0)
tests/online-accounts-ui/mock/notification-mock.cpp (+81/-0)
tests/online-accounts-ui/mock/notification-mock.h (+66/-0)
tests/online-accounts-ui/mock/request-mock.cpp (+136/-0)
tests/online-accounts-ui/mock/request-mock.h (+64/-0)
tests/online-accounts-ui/online-accounts-ui.pro (+2/-1)
tests/online-accounts-ui/tst_notification.cpp (+33/-0)
tests/online-accounts-ui/tst_signonui_request.cpp (+338/-0)
tests/online-accounts-ui/tst_signonui_request.pro (+53/-0)
Branch information
Recent revisions
- 130. By Alberto Mardegan
-
From trunk
* Add forgotten test-dep on ubuntu-
ui-toolkit- autopilot.
[ Leo Arias ]
* Refactored the autopilot tests to use the page object pattern. Added
the method go to add account to be used in UX tests.
[ MichaĆ Sawicz ]
* New icon from suru theme. - 129. By Alberto Mardegan
-
Implement account reauthentication and reauthorization
The need for a user interaction might arise at any time, depending on the remote service's policy. It will typically happen when an access token expires, or when an application requests new permissions or changes its key.
In order not to disrupt the user's activity, we preliminary implement this as a snap decision (as was suggested in https://docs.google. com/a/canonical .com/document/ d/1puQ9Z0yKqzsQ 1VQ1OOBkxgp78iW GnAhAkFXWJFTWIr E/edit# heading= h.topn0ejru38u). However, since design has not yet come up with a definitive approach, we keep the UI strings untranslated since they are not final.
Branch metadata
- Branch format:
- Branch format 7
- Repository format:
- Bazaar repository format 2a (needs bzr 1.16 or later)